Main duties of the job

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ES

· Making professional, autonomous decisions in relation to presenting problems, whether self‐referred or referred from other health care workers within the organisation

· Assessing the health care needs of patients with undifferentiated and undiagnosed problems screening patients for disease risk factors and early signs of illness

· Admitting or discharging patients to and from the caseload and referring to other care providers as appropriate

· Recording clear and contemporaneous consultation notes to agreed standards, collecting data for audit purposes

· In general, the post‐holder will be expected to undertake all the normal duties and responsibilities associated with a GP working within primary care.

· Awareness of and compliance with all relevant practice policies/guidelines

· Collaboratively work with Primary Care Networks

About us

Salford Primary Care Together is a not-for profit CIC that operates in 3 areas of Salford that are ranked as some of the most deprived areas of Greater Manchester. SPCT’s aim is to deliver high quality primary care services to improve the health outcomes of our populations whilst tacking health inequalities and working with some of the most marginalised patients in the country. Our Inclusion team helps the most vulnerable people in our region, it is a GP service that supports people experiencing homelessness and other marginalised groups, across Salford through the removal of common barriers in accessing healthcare. Our other services are the EPiC service that provides 24-hour primary and urgent care to the region, our Academy service, that provides the practical training of new generations of nurses and our three GP Practices (Eccles Gateway, Willow Tree and Little Hulton) that strives to deliver the best patient care through our values-driven, profit for purpose ethos.
